Job Summary

The Financial Analyst I is responsible for analyzing financial data, preparing reports, and assisting with budgeting and forecasting processes to support decision-making within the facility. This role involves gathering and interpreting financial information, monitoring trends, and ensuring financial data integrity. The Financial Analyst I collaborates with leadership and department managers to provide insights into financial performance, cost control, and operational efficiency.

Essential Functions

Analyzes financial data and trends to support budgeting, forecasting, and financial planning activities.

Prepares financial reports and presentations, summarizing key findings and providing recommendations for decision-making.

Assists in developing annual budgets and financial forecasts, ensuring accuracy and alignment with organizational goals.

Monitors financial performance metrics, identifying variances and working with departments to address discrepancies.

Supports month-end and year-end financial closing activities, including journal entries, reconciliations, and variance analysis.

Conducts cost analysis and expense monitoring, assisting in identifying cost-saving opportunities.

Collaborates with various departments to gather financial data and ensure accurate reporting.

Ensures compliance with financial policies, procedures, and regulatory requirements.

Utilizes financial software and systems to maintain accurate and organized financial records.
